Analysis of Gene Expression Profiles in the Liver of Rats With Intrauterine Growth Retardation
BACKGROUND: Intrauterine growth restriction (IUGR) is highly associated with fetal as well as neonatal morbidity, mortality, and an increased risk metabolic disease development later in life.
